Garden decor

As we were looking/cleaning things out of the garage for spring we came across some wooden decor that Eric had made back when we were in Michigan. 
 He did a really nice job with them and thought that we would clean them up put some protector on them and put it in our garden. The boys were really excited when they seen them, most of all there was a gorilla  which has become there new favorite zoo animal. 
 After cleaning the spider webs off and sanding them a little bit it was time to put on a clear coat of the wood protector. The boys love to paint so they each grabbed a brush a went to town. I surprisingly had to do very little. Thomas did a really nice job and Sup had put so much on his brush each time I just used his extra to do the edges :)
We had three all together and were able to do the front and edges all in about a half hour. The next day after they were dry we did the backs, let them dry. After the backs were dry Eric put them on some wooden stakes and we have a little character to our garden :) It was a fun little family project.
